Quality Control in Practice

The cheapest quality control step is a retained sample. Keeping three sealed units from every jasmine ice batch costs almost nothing and turns any dispute into a simple comparison instead of an argument over photographs.

What Jasmine Ice Really Costs Landed

Margin on jasmine ice is rarely lost at the till. It is lost through dead stock, returns and emergency air freight. A slightly higher landed cost with predictable lead time usually beats the cheapest quote on the spreadsheet.

When you model jasmine ice pricing, build in a realistic shrink figure. Even a well run line loses a small percentage to damage, expiry and sampling. Pretending that number is zero is how a healthy looking margin turns negative.

Indicative reference points for planning purposes: entry tier from USD 1.65 per unit at 500 units, mid tier at USD 0.99, and volume tier at USD 0.56 for full container quantities. These figures move with specification, packaging and freight, so treat them as a shape rather than a quote.

What to Fix Before Approving Jasmine Ice

Two specifications that matter more than buyers expect: the seal integrity after a drop test and the consistency of the draw from first use to last. Both are measurable before you commit to volume.

Revisit the jasmine ice specification after every third order. Small improvements compound, and factories take a buyer more seriously when the document has clearly been used.

Getting Jasmine Ice to Your Warehouse

Freight is the hidden half of jasmine ice unit economics. A denser master carton can save more per unit than a hard negotiation on factory price, because the saving repeats on every reorder rather than once.

Model jasmine ice freight both ways before choosing a method: cost per unit and cost per week of delay. The second figure is the one that decides whether a cheap option was actually cheap.
